Abstract
The ratio of the bend to splay elastic constant of a binary liquid cry stalline mixture (5CB/ME60.5) which show injected smectic phase, has b een determined by Freedericksz transition in nematic phase, results of which have been reported here. It has been found that K-3/K-1 values show a divergence as the injected smectic phase is approached. The K-3 /K-1 values also show a minimum near equimolar concentration, which is similar to the minimum in other physical properties of this mixture a t this concentration found by previous workers.
